A Rare And Finely Carved Green-Overlay White Glass Snuff Bottle. Attributed To The Imperial Glassworks, Beijing, 1760-1820
A Rare And Finely Carved Green-Overlay White Glass Snuff Bottle. Attributed To The Imperial Glassworks, Beijing, 1760-1820. Photo: Christie's Images Ltd 2012
The flattened, pear-shaped bottle is finely carved through the pale green glass on either side with a writhing chilong, one of which is shown biting its tail. The narrow sides are carved with masks suspending fixed rings. 2 5/16 in (5.8 cm.) high, coral stopper with vinyl collar - Estimate $5,000 - $7,000
